Bet on Netflix for video game it doesn’t work well for the platform.

According to Apptopiathese games Netflix 1.7 million users play daily, which is less than 1% of the platform’s 221 million subscribers.

Games not “so” welcome

In total, according to CNBCgames Netflix they were downloaded about 23.3 million times.

“We are going to experiment and try a lot of things. But I would say that in the long term, the prize is that we will focus more on our ability to create objects related to the universes, characters and stories that we create,” said Greg Peters, COO Netflixannouncing the arrival of these titles.

“We are still intentionally keeping the information private because we are still learning and experimenting and trying to figure out what will really resonate with our members, what games people want to play,” says Lynn Lumbe, director of external relations. games.

Keep in mind that many of these games need to be manually downloaded by searching the Play Store and App Store for Android and iOS.

Games for a change

Betting on video games is not a first for streaming services, as Amazon Prime Video works closely with Prime Gaming, which not only gives away well-known games, but also provides bonuses for very popular games.

Netflixhowever, has turned its content towards mobile games, and many of them are based on its original products, such as Weird things.
